NEW YORK One week after Charlottesville, the Resistance is planning its next move. Members of a group calling itself Resist Fascism met in five cities around the country on Saturday with the intent to plan and organize nationwide demonstrations later this year. Their goal, according to Eva Sahana, a 22 year-old organizer, is simply to drive out the Trump and Pence fascist regime.
The planning is still in its early stages, but the organizers have an idea in mind. On Saturday, November 4approximately a year after President Donald Trumps electionmembers of the Resistance will descend on Americas major cities. Theyll march and demonstrate, as they have in the past, but this time, say organizers, they wont go home at the end of the day. Instead, the plan is to occupy city centers and parks and not leave until, and only until, Trump and Vice President Mike Pence have fallen.
Outrages that once shocked people about this regime arent quite as shocking anymore, said Sahana. We need to act now, before people have learned to accept the unacceptable.
The lead organizers at the New York conference are a disparate bunch. They include a Maoist activist and a leftist bookstore owner and anti-gun advocate who describe themselves as anti-fascist but differentiate themselves from the Antifa, the black-clad protesters who have clashed violently with white supremacists and the alt-right at Charlottesville and the University of California, Berkeley. The organizers disillusionment with electoral politics and radical talk of regime change sets them apart, too, from more moderate organizations within the so-called Resistance, such as Indivisible or Swing Left, two constituent-based activist groups that formed in the wake of Trumps election........................................
The New York meeting, which included around 90 people, took place at a community center only a short walk from Zuccotti Park, where Occupy Wall Street got its start six years ago. The plan for November 4 resembles that 2011 protest in more ways than one. Not only does the tactic of urban occupation directly stem from Occupy Wall Street, but several Resist Fascism organizers were active participants in the Zuccotti Park protestsexperience that made them sound like hardened veterans dishing out tactical advice to the new recruits. .......................................
